WebNov 18, 2024 · The violin is the soprano of the string instruments, with a range that spans from a low G below middle C (G 3) to as high as the violinist can reach, usually around E 7, or two octaves above the open E.The violin is tuned in fifths: G 3, D 4, A 4, and E 5.Each of these strings has a wide range, with the lowest pitch being the open string.

WebA string’s length, thickness, and tension are what produce various tones from the instrument. Tighter, shorter strings create quicker, higher pitched tones, while longer, looser strings create lower, drawn-out ones. Thick strings will sound very deep compared to those that are thinner, where the sound is tiny and high.
